Village Cottage with an Amazing Water View

Located in Historic Castine Village with spectacular views across the harbor to Cape Rosier and of the grand schooners coming in under full sail.

This charming, fully equipped cottage is just sixty feet from the waters edge and has easy steps leading down to the beach.

A unique blend of a small New England town with a common and seafaring village, Castine is exceptionally picturesque. Many of its homes date back to the American Revolution and the streets remain lined with majestic, hundred year old Elm trees.

Not many towns can boast more in the way of recreation, cultural activities and community services, yet remain so unspoiled by commercial tourism. There are no traffic lights and no fast food chains but amenities include sailing, kayaking, golf, tennis, the Maine Maritime Academy pool and fitness facilities, churches, a library, restaurants, museums, a small grocery store, a doctors office and musical concert on the this just a short stroll from Moonrise Anchorage.

One Queen bed, one double bed, two twins and a queen size sleeper sofa. Large deck facing the harbor with a charcoal grill and plenty of outdoor seating and an umbrella to provide shade. Private beach just steps from the front door.
